Here are some photos of me and my friend trying to catch freshwater pipefish in Dniester river. these are actually marine species, but they have been invading rivers lately and now are living and breeding in complete freshwater. these are Syngnathus nigrolineatus or black lined pipefish
I looked them up and the iucn red list site lists them as least concern and that their natural habitats include marine, brackish and fresh. Obviously they can deal with a range of conditions.
